epassporte phishing email doing the rounds
 
FYI Just got one an hour ago so keep an eye out for it. I think most people are conditioned not to click on the paypal ones but this is I think the second ever from epass for me. Gmail didn't catch it as phishing either.


Dear user of ePassporte services,

Due to upcoming year 2006, and recent changes in ePassporte's Service Agreement you need to submit additional details on your ePassporte account. Starting from 2006 all ePassporte accounts will come with complete detailed information! Identity protection matters. And ePassporte works day and night to help keep your identity safe.

Identity protection matters. Get Verified!
According the new changes in Service Agreement any unverified account will be deleted from the system in 72 hours after receiving this letter.

etc etc
